diff options
author | Hsieh Chin Fan <pham@topo.tw> | 2025-02-24 10:01:57 +0800 |
---|---|---|
committer | Hsieh Chin Fan <pham@topo.tw> | 2025-02-24 10:01:57 +0800 |
commit | 729f939b33a8a30206e1861a693c6bcb90d5d2b5 (patch) | |
tree | 0f73ec7eb3252baf045484c67587a692a06a70f6 | |
parent | 327f4c1f8a6fb9f4c7accbf94d7b0dba429f3cad (diff) |
Update
-rw-r--r-- | smtpd/smtpd.conf |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/smtpd/smtpd.conf b/smtpd/smtpd.conf index 58c984f..52c2b56 100644 --- a/smtpd/smtpd.conf +++ b/smtpd/smtpd.conf | |||
@@ -15,9 +15,9 @@ pki mail.topo.tw key "/etc/mail/ssl/mail.topo.tw.key" | |||
15 | # DKIM, command: | 15 | # DKIM, command: |
16 | # sudo PIPX_HOME=/opt/pipx PIPX_BIN_DIR=/usr/local/bin pipx install --force git+https://github.com/palant/opensmtpd-filters.git | 16 | # sudo PIPX_HOME=/opt/pipx PIPX_BIN_DIR=/usr/local/bin pipx install --force git+https://github.com/palant/opensmtpd-filters.git |
17 | # refs: https://palant.info/2020/11/09/adding-dkim-support-to-opensmtpd-with-custom-filters/ | 17 | # refs: https://palant.info/2020/11/09/adding-dkim-support-to-opensmtpd-with-custom-filters/ |
18 | filter dkimsign proc-exec "/usr/local/bin/dkimsign topo.tw:dkim:/etc/mail/dkim.key" | 18 | #filter dkimsign proc-exec "/usr/local/bin/dkimsign topo.tw:dkim:/etc/mail/dkim.key" |
19 | filter dkimverify proc-exec "/usr/local/bin/dkimverify topo.tw" | 19 | #filter dkimverify proc-exec "/usr/local/bin/dkimverify topo.tw" |
20 | filter dkim chain {"dkimsign", "dkimverify"} | 20 | #filter dkim chain {"dkimsign", "dkimverify"} |
21 | 21 | ||
22 | # refs: https://man.openbsd.org/table.5 | 22 | # refs: https://man.openbsd.org/table.5 |
23 | table passwd file:/etc/mail/passwd | 23 | table passwd file:/etc/mail/passwd |
@@ -28,8 +28,8 @@ table passwd file:/etc/mail/passwd | |||
28 | # listen on 0.0.0.0 | 28 | # listen on 0.0.0.0 |
29 | # listen on :: | 29 | # listen on :: |
30 | listen on lo | 30 | listen on lo |
31 | listen on enp1s0 inet4 hostname "mail.topo.tw" port 25 tls pki mail.topo.tw filter "dkim" | 31 | listen on enp1s0 inet4 hostname "mail.topo.tw" port 25 tls pki mail.topo.tw |
32 | listen on enp1s0 inet4 hostname "mail.topo.tw" port 587 tls-require mask-src pki mail.topo.tw auth-optional <passwd> filter "dkim" | 32 | listen on enp1s0 inet4 hostname "mail.topo.tw" port 587 tls-require mask-src pki mail.topo.tw auth-optional <passwd> |
33 | 33 | ||
34 | # Allow delivery from local or domain-owned-by-me | 34 | # Allow delivery from local or domain-owned-by-me |
35 | action "me" maildir virtual { "@" = "pham" } | 35 | action "me" maildir virtual { "@" = "pham" } |